23-year-old Heather Tookey lives in the English town of Becknehemen. And her family has an unusual pet.
This story began a few years ago. Once Heather went to South Africa as a seasonal volunteer.
She was at the cheetah reserve.
One of the duties of the society’s staff was to care for orphaned cheetahs.
The volunteers also took care of the adults. It was a kind of business.
The animals were to become trophies for wealthy clients.
Then it occurred to Heather: She has to save the cheetahs. At least one.
Heather started a promotion on social media. She needed to raise a certain amount of money.
The woman’s efforts paid off in full. All cheetahs were purchased and transported to reserves.
Heather invested her own 5,000 pounds and took home a little cheetah kitten.
So she had a new friend.
The woman’s efforts are not enough to stop the cheetah breeding business.
But Heather just could not close her eyes from this occupation.
The cheetah feels comfortable in the company of her rescuer. The spotted pet is very affectionate and friendly. They both have charming, warm selfies. Now the woman is no longer afraid, because next to her is a devoted cheetah friend!
